Top neighborhoods in Hvar

Hvar Old Town

Hvar Old Town captivates visitors with its honey-colored stone buildings and red-tiled roofs. Wander narrow cobblestone streets to discover the medieval St. Stephen's Cathedral, 16th-century Venetian Loggia, and ancient city walls. The Arsenal theater and peaceful Franciscan monastery offer glimpses into Croatia's rich maritime past. Soak up spectacular Adriatic views along the palm-lined harbor promenade. Upscale seafood restaurants and traditional konobas serve fresh catches and local wines with waterfront views. Boutique hotels in converted palaces provide luxury accommodations with historic charm. The compact layout makes everything walkable within 10 minutes, though water taxis are available for island-hopping adventures.

Learn more about Hvar

Between the lavender-scented hills and crystal Adriatic waters, a medieval town unfolds like a historical treasure map. Climb to Hvar Fortress for panoramic views that explain why Venetians fought to control this strategic harbor. The 1612 theater – one of Europe's oldest – anchors a cultural scene that would impress cities ten times its size. By day, sail to the Pakleni Islands' hidden coves where the water shifts between impossible shades of blue. After sunset, the harbor transforms as yachts disgorge beautiful people into seafront bars. For a quieter experience, explore the stone lanes behind St. Stephen's Square, where locals tend centuries-old family homes. The beaches at Mekicevica and Pokonji Dol offer perfect swimming without the crowds of the main harbor.

Where to stay near Hvar

In Bol, Stari Grad, Jelsa, each offers unique charms: Bol impresses with windsurfing, diving, and its scenic marina; Stari Grad captivates with its rich history, elegant port, and leisurely walks by the sea; while Jelsa entices with adventurous kayaking, secluded swimming spots, and archaeological intrigue. For first-time visitors, Bol is best suited for its diverse appeal.

  1. BolOpens in a new window: Bol is a vibrant spot perfect for water enthusiasts. With a strong focus on windsurfing and kitesurfing, it’s a great base for those who love the sea and diving. You can explore must-see places like Bol Marina and relax by Zlatni Rat Beach, enjoying the unique charm of this coastal town. The mix of leisure at the marina and the natural beauty of its beaches makes Bol a refreshing getaway for travelers seeking a blend of adventure and relaxation.
  2. Stari GradOpens in a new window: Stari Grad offers a blend of historical charm and seaside leisure. It's ideal for travelers who appreciate exploring the rich past while enjoying the calm of the sea. Here, you can walk around the port, enjoy boating, and check out must-see spots like Lanterna Beach and Tvrdalj Castle. This small coastal town provides an intimate feel with its distinct maritime character, making it a delightful choice for those who want to dive into local culture without the hustle of a big city.

Best time to go to Hvar

Hvar exper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 49.5°F (9.7°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 78.4°F (25.8°C). November is usually the wettest month. June to August are the peak travel months in Hvar,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, accompanied by no rainfall. On the other hand, October to December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light to moderate r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
